The tape has a physical write protect mechanism. On 3490s there's a thumbwheel on the
tape and if you turn it until the flat surface shows, then it's write protected. Other
types of tapes such as 8mm Exabytes may have break-off tabs like those on music
cassettes.

Try the command :
mtlib -l librarypcname -CV volumename -t FF10
This will force eject the tape by setting category to FF10
run /usr/bin/mtlib with option -? to see all options
